Hello, I have been sorting a list of dicts using the following
function:
result_rs = sorted(unsort_rs, key=itemgetter(orderby))
and this works fine. Now I am looking to perform a subsort as well.
For example, I have this:
test = [{'name': 'John Smith', 'location': 'CA',},{'name': 'John
Smith', 'location': 'AZ',},]
I would want to sort by name first, then sub sort by location. Any
ideas? Thanks!
